How many ants are there for 1 human?

Every human on the planet has about 1 million ants in their midst. More than 12,000 species of ants are known to exist in the world, and 50 of these can be found in the United Kingdom alone.

Do ants outweigh humans on Earth?

“Each worker weighs between 1 and 5 mg, depending on the species. The combined weight of all the world’s ants is about the same as that of all the people on the planet.” According to Wilson and Hoelldobler, the average human weighs one million times more than an ant.
